L'année exacte n'est pas entièrement certaine en raison de multiples affirmations contradictoires. Un examen des preuves historiques existantes, menée par Pieters et ses collègues en 2012, suggère que la date la plus précise de la découverte serait vers 1780[14]. Plus récemment, des journaux limbourgeois rapportent en 2015 qu'Ernst Homburg(en) a découvert un magazine liégeois paru en , relatant en détail la découverte récente du deuxième crâne[15].
